godwarf: assert children are not ignored (#2388)

The godwarf package provides two ways to turn a dwarf.Entry into a
godwarf.Tree: LoadTree and EntryToTree. The former doesn't handle
children - it doesn't advance a Reader past them (in fact, it doesn't
even know about a Reader). EntryToTree is only used for variables and
formal param DIEs, which don't have children, and it would very likely
be incorrect to use it for DIEs with children. This patch makes the
function panic if the entry can have children.
